Factors Affecting Car Insurance Rates in Arizona
Several factors can impact your car insurance premiums in Arizona. Understanding these can help you make informed decisions when choosing a policy:
- Driving Record: A clean driving record with no accidents or violations significantly lowers your insurance rate. Conversely, speeding tickets or accidents can increase your premiums.
- Type of Vehicle: The make, model, and age of your vehicle play a crucial role in determining your insurance rate. Generally, cars with high safety ratings and lower theft rates attract cheaper premiums.
- Location: Arizona is home to a variety of environments, and where you live can influence your insurance costs. Urban areas often have higher rates due to increased risk and traffic congestion.
- Coverage Level: The amount of coverage you choose impacts your premium. Opting for minimum liability coverage can lower costs, but it’s important to ensure adequate protection.
- Deductibles: The deductible is the amount you'll pay out-of-pocket before insurance kicks in. Higher deductibles typically lower your premium but could leave you with more expenses in the event of a claim.

Tips for Finding the Best Rates
To further ensure that you are getting the best car insurance rates in Arizona, consider the following tips:
- Shop Around: Comparing quotes from multiple insurance companies can help you identify the most economical option for your needs.
- Utilize Discounts: Inquire about available discounts. Many insurers offer discounts for safe driving, low mileage, and good student performance.
- Maintain Good Credit: Insurance companies in Arizona often consider credit scores when determining premiums. A better credit score can lead to lower rates.
- Review Annually: Changes in your life circumstances can affect your insurance rates. Regularly reviewing your policy can help you remain on the best plan for your current situation.
